The Heat Resistance Challenge

While organic glues excel in environmental friendliness, their thermal stability remains controversial. Our tests show:

Adhesive Type Max Temp Resistance Degradation Rate
Synthetic Epoxy 180°C 0.5%/100h
Plant-Based Glue 135°C 1.2%/100h

Future Trends in Battery Adhesives

Emerging solutions aim to bridge the performance gap:

  • Nano-cellulose reinforced binders (15% higher shear strength)
  • Bio-based conductive adhesives (resistivity < 10-3 Ω·cm)
  • Self-healing organic compounds

When to Choose Organic Adhesives

Consider these factors for your project:

  • Yes, if: Operating temps below 100°C | Eco-certification needed | Easy recycling prioritized
  • No, if: High-power applications | Extreme environments | Cost-sensitive mass production

FAQ: Organic Adhesives in Battery Packs

  • Q: Are organic glues fire-resistant? A: They meet basic UL94 HB ratings but require additional fire retardants for high-risk applications.
  • Q: How do costs compare? A: Currently 20-30% higher than synthetic alternatives, but prices dropping 5-7% annually.
